DOCUMENTATION = """
module: junos_vlans
short_description: VLANs resource module
description:
- This module creates and manages VLAN configurations on Junos OS.
version_added: 1.0.0
author: Daniel Mellado (@dmellado)
requirements:
- ncclient (>=v0.6.4)
notes:
- This module requires the netconf system service be enabled on the remote device
being managed
- Tested against Junos OS 18.4R1
- This module works with connection C(netconf).
- See L(the Junos OS Platform Options,https://docs.ansible.com/ansible/latest/network/user_guide/platform_junos.html).
options:
config:
description: A dictionary of Vlan options
type: list
elements: dict
suboptions:
vlan_id:
description:
- IEEE 802.1q VLAN identifier for VLAN (1..4094).
type: int
name:
description:
- Name of VLAN.
type: str
required: true
description:
description:
- Text description of VLANs
type: str
l3_interface:
description:
- Name of logical layer 3 interface.
type: str
running_config:
description:
- This option is used only with state I(parsed).
- The value of this option should be the output received from the Junos device
by executing the command B(show vlans).
- The state I(parsed) reads the configuration from C(running_config) option and
transforms it into Ansible structured data as per the resource module's argspec
and the value is then returned in the I(parsed) key within the result
type: str
state:
description:
- The state of the configuration after module completion.
type: str
choices:
- merged
- replaced
- overridden
- deleted
- gathered
- parsed
- rendered
default: merged
"""
EXAMPLES = """
# Using merged
#
# Before state
# ------------
#
# vagrant@vsrx# show vlans
#
# [edit]
- name: Merge provided Junos vlans config with running-config
junipernetworks.junos.junos_vlans:
config:
- name: vlan1
vlan_id: 1
- name: vlan2
vlan_id: 2
l3_interface: irb.12
state: merged
#
# -------------------------
# Module Execution Result
# -------------------------
# "after": [
# {
# "name": "vlan1",
# "vlan_id": 1
# },
# {
# "l3_interface": "irb.12",
# "name": "vlan2",
# "vlan_id": 2
# }
# ],
# "before": [],
# "changed": true,
# "commands": [
# "<nc:vlans xmlns:nc="urn:ietf:params:xml:ns:netconf:base:1.0">"
# "<nc:vlan><nc:name>vlan1</nc:name><nc:vlan-id>1</nc:vlan-id></nc:vlan>"
# "<nc:vlan><nc:name>vlan2</nc:name><nc:vlan-id>2</nc:vlan-id><nc:l3-interface>irb.12</nc:l3-interface>"
# "</nc:vlan></nc:vlans>"
# ]
# After state
# -----------
#
# vagrant@vsrx# show vlans
# vlan1 {
# vlan-id 1;
# }
# vlan2 {
# vlan-id 2;
# l3-interface irb.12;
# }
# Using replaced
#
# Before state
# ------------
#
# vagrant@vsrx# show vlans
# vlan1 {
# vlan-id 1;
# }
# vlan2 {
# vlan-id 2;
# l3-interface irb.12;
# }
- name: Replace Junos vlans running-config with the provided config
junipernetworks.junos.junos_vlans:
config:
- name: vlan1
vlan_id: 11
l3_interface: irb.10
- name: vlan2
vlan_id: 2
state: replaced
# -------------------------
# Module Execution Result
# -------------------------
# "after": [
# {
# "l3_interface": "irb.10",
# "name": "vlan1",
# "vlan_id": 11
# },
# {
# "name": "vlan2",
# "vlan_id": 2
# }
# ],
# "before": [
# {
# "name": "vlan1",
# "vlan_id": 1
# },
# {
# "l3_interface": "irb.12",
# "name": "vlan2",
# "vlan_id": 2
# }
# ],
# "changed": true,
# "commands": [
# "<nc:vlans xmlns:nc="urn:ietf:params:xml:ns:netconf:base:1.0">"
# "<nc:vlan delete="delete"><nc:name>vlan1</nc:name></nc:vlan>"
# "<nc:vlan delete="delete"><nc:name>vlan2</nc:name></nc:vlan>"
# "<nc:vlan><nc:name>vlan1</nc:name><nc:vlan-id>11</nc:vlan-id>"
# "<nc:l3-interface>irb.10</nc:l3-interface></nc:vlan><nc:vlan>"
# "<nc:name>vlan2</nc:name><nc:vlan-id>2</nc:vlan-id></nc:vlan></nc:vlans>"
# ]
# After state
# -----------
#
# vagrant@vsrx# show vlans
# vlan1 {
# vlan-id 11;
# l3-interface irb.10;
# }
# vlan2 {
# vlan-id 2;
# }
#
